Hello, i want to run Age of Empires 2 on my Windows 7 rc computer. But there are color issuse when i run it, the grass aren't green and the water isent blue. How should i do to fix this? I have try to run it complatify with windows xp service pack 2, and installd some driexct 9 drivers. but not result to better colors. I hope someone have a good answer, because i love this game.

Go into task manager select the processes tab and end explorer.exe then alt-tab back into age of empires

Note: this will make your task bar disapear and any open folders

To restart explorer open the task manager agian in the aplications tab hit new task and type explorer in the box

The colours change because of the Aero theme's poor handling of colours

Edit:

You can also make a batch file with the following lines and place it in the same location as your age of empires 2 executable

taskkill /F /IM Explorer.exe

age2_x1.exe

Start explorer.exe

    I've had the same problems. Water is purple, grass is grainy, and teal is yellow while purple is blue (on the map that is).

    I've got II without the expansion(s?) and both the "disable visual themes" method and the "open up screen resolution window" method have not worked...

    I'd try the batch method, but seeing as this is a family computer, whenever I alt-tab out of AoE it is because somebody needs to check their email or similar and having to reboot explorer and close it again would just get annoying...

    What other methods have I not tried that do not involve closing explorer?

    EDIT: Earlier I didn't see the step involving going to a windows classic theme. Doing that and opening screen resolution did the trick...
